Hmmm.





There's no denying the image is pretty. But in all the squee I've been seeing on the Glambert comms, nobody seems to have commented that the boy has been Photoshopped so hard he doesn't actually look much like Adam Lambert any more. He's turned into an adorable little waif (look at that slender chest! Where does he get the breath to sing the way he does?) with flawless skin and no substance.

Do we really need our idols to be artificial? Really?
